Role Summary:
The (USA) Specialist, Business Support plays a critical role in facilitating efficient business operations by collaborating with stakeholders to manage tasks and support initiatives. This individual will help with program tasks, coordinating meetings, and providing support to ensure the program runs smoothly.
The individual may be flexed to assist other groups within the boarder Global Ethics team as business needs arise, providing support on projects, initiatives, or daily operations outside of their primary responsibilities. The ideal candidate should have strong organizational skills, excellent communication abilities, and the 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.
About the Team:The Ethics Governance team is dedicated to upholding the company’s commitment to integrity by developing and enforcing ethics policies aligned with legal standards and the Code of Conduct. The team manages key programs such as Conflicts of Interest and Integrity in Action, ensuring their effective operation. By delivering clear reports on ethics data and trends to executive leadership, the team supports informed decision-making. Focused on transparency, accountability, and ethical practices, the team plays a vital role in protecting the company’s reputation and fostering a respectful and positive workplace environment.

Live Better U is a Walmart-paid education benefit program for full-time and part-time associates in Walmart and Sam's Club facilities. Programs range from high school completion to bachelor's degrees, including English Language Learning and short-form certificates. Tuition, books, and fees are completely paid for by Walmart.
